Or to have a potentiometer choose how much comes from a capacitor and how much from an inductor.
This simulation selects a range between phase advance or retard.
The potentiometer was dialed from left to right during the run. The scope trace tells the story. Notice at the beginning, output phase leads the source. By the end, output lags.

These values seemed suitable for 5 MHz. They were chosen to attenuate the source 5V amplitude about half. To select values your own project 1-30 MHz may require some trade-offs in performance.
There is another possibility: make a series LC. Ground one end, apply your signal to the other end. Tap for output between the L & C.
Reverse the LC, to obtain different behavior.
